- [ ] **Step 7: Breaker override escrow.** After sealing the signing keys for the Tallgrove upstream API circuit breaker, confirm the support team can force the breaker open during a full outage. The override bundle lives in the sealed escrow drawer and is useless without its unlock phrase. Two ceremony witnesses must initial this step before proceeding. The escrow bundle is decrypted with the recovery passphrase that follows.

vault phrase of kahip-kahop = holath-quenmir

Heads up, support folks: Graphlet 2.3 ships Friday with the new dependency graph visualizer. If customers report blank canvases, have them clear the layout cache first — fixes it nine times out of ten. Escalations go to the Marrow team channel. When re-issuing a hotfix bundle, you'll need to sign it with the key below.

deploy key for kajof-fajop: bky6_gDHw9Q

### Fee Rules Engine — Plugin Runbook

Tollgate evaluates shipping-fee rules in priority order and stops at the first terminal match. Plugin authors should register rules under a unique namespace so reloads do not clobber built-ins. If a rule throws, Tollgate logs the failure and falls back to the flat-rate default; it never blocks checkout. Test plugins against the staging tier in Verrow before promotion. The engine loads its runtime settings from the values shown below.

deployment values, kajep-kageg:
[praix]
host = praix.paliqcorp.corp
user = praix_svc
database = praix_prod